    With slight overclocking, it should be really close to a GTX 460 768mb edition. 570m has a 575mhz core clock and 750mhz (3ghz data rate) on a 192bit mem bus. GTX 460 768mb has a 675mhz on a 900mhz (3.6ghz data rate) on a 192 bit mem bus.

    Nice benchmarks btw... especially the battery test.
    3:20 web browsing, almost 3 hours playing a blu-ray (that's the one with the SSD)

    Playing a blu-ray is fairly significant usage as it uses screen and sound to the fullest, gives the video card and processor something to do for the whole time (although not near capacity) and even activates the wireless or network if available as most blu-ray phone home for "additional content".
    It represents one of the worst-case battery drains in a realistic environment.
    (one of the highest drain things you would actually use battery for)

    I think what we have seen of benchmarks thus far, can only be viewed as an 'idea' of the GTX 570M's capability.

    I understand Rob's point, and my scores were very similar, but there really isn't anything wrong with 'tinkering' (optimizing)..... so long as the benchmark testing is within the guidelines established by 3DMark. After all, the objective of 'PAID' 3DMark users is to achieve the highest scores possible..... for 3DMark submission and bragging rights.

    Personally for me, none of the benchmarks we've seen carry much weight, because none are valid for 3DMark submission...... or they do not meet 3DMark's requirements. This will not occur until we see approved drivers for our new GTX 570M.

    Approved Drivers for Use with 3DMark Video Card Benchmark Tests

    At present, there are no valid 3DMark GTX 570M submissions, ergo all benchmarking heretofore is somewhat a moot point. Search HERE!

    This is why I am patiently awaiting the 570M's addition to nVidia's Verde driver package...... which I anticipate in the next official final release. And what of 'modded' drivers you say? Well, they have to be approved by 3DMark too.

    Instead of just benchmark screenshots, we need to see more official links of actual 3DMark submissions..... and the 570M standing in that roster. Otherwise, there are no controls or benchmark standards..... and 'fudging' is sure to be rampant.

    Well, lets be honest about any of the 3dmark series...

    ANY results of ANY TEST are invalid without the settings the test is done at.

    The whole point of people using the free version at defaults is that they are done at defaults... this is the basics of how to create a comparison.

    Honestly, the free results are more telling than the non-default paid versions.

    Also, I don't really think 3dmark's "approval" on a driver makes any real difference as to how reliable anyone thinks the results are...

    On the other hand, you are correct about full supported drivers from Nvidia affecting scores. They almost always go up once nvidia officially recoginizes the new model.

    I7 840Qm is not compatible with GTX 780. You will need the new Sandy Bridge 2XXX QM series processors like 2630QM, 2720QM, 2820 QM or 2920XM. You can also go for newer 2760QM or 2860Qm or 2960XM processors.
    These 840Qm are last gen I7 processors which are not compatible with the chipsets in GTX 780R.
